Title :
Research of Chaos Encryption Algorithm Based on Logistic Mapping
Author :
Luo, Jinhong ; Shi, Haiyi
Author_Institution :
South China Univ. of Tech., China
Abstract :
With the development of network technique and the increasing frequency of information exchange, the research of information security technique is getting more and more important. As a special nonlinear phenomenon, chaos has many properties worthy to be applied. Chaos cryptogram has a considerable advantage in the encryption of multimedia information. Basing on the character that most information on the Internet today is transmitted in the form of stream and transferred from the initial crunode to other crunodes in the form of one dimension data in the sequence of plain message ,we propose to adjust the corresponding sequence of key encryption and plain message to improve anti-decryption greatly and shows its merits and demerits by analyzing this arithmetic.
